Effect of Temperature on Peroxidase(POD) Isozymes in Winter Wheat Seedlings

Abstract: The POD isozymes in radicle and plumule of two winter wheat seedlings (Zhongyin-15and 81-1 )were significantly affected after treatment by different temperatures(25℃, 30℃,40 ℃,50℃)and times (2, 4, 8, 16, 24, 48 hours), Its bands increased when treatment time prolonged at normal temperature(25℃).At 30℃, POD isozymes showed curve changes.The bands increased with the lengthening of the treatment time,but the bands decreased after reaching at a definite time.The peak value is related to the characteristics of variety and sampling position.The tendency of bands decreased at high temperature (40℃, 50℃), and decreased sharply after a period of treatment.The ability of high temperature tolerance is varited significantly among winter wheat varieties.

Key words: Peroxidase (POD) isozyme, Winter wheat, High temperature-tolerance, Treatment time
